Physical Examination

 Your pediatrician will do a complete physical exam of your newborn. They will remove all the clothing so that they can see the entire body. The first step is to look good over the baby. Does everything look right? Does the baby have a good color? Are the hips aligned, and are the legs the same length? They will verify all the observations made during the initial exam, which took place minutes after birth. The infant has two major soft spots on the top of the head called fontanels. The doctor will check these and discuss how to care for them with you. The umbilical cord will also be examined to make sure all is well. 

Measurements

 Your newborn will be weighed and measured to see how it compares with others of its age. The circumference of the head will also be taken. The baby's temperature is taken, their heart and lungs are listened to, and their reactions are observed. The earlier anything out of the ordinary is observed, the sooner it can be corrected. 

Questions

 Your pediatrician will ask you a lot of questions about feeding, sleeping, and how you are coping with the youngest member of the family. This is your chance to get some answers as well. Have a list of questions that you will present to the doctor. Don't be afraid to ask anything. There are no stupid questions; chances are, you are not the first to ask the doctor these questions.
